+Subject: dix: GetHosts bounds check using wrong pointer value [CVE-2014-8092
+ pt. 6]
+
+GetHosts saves the pointer to allocated memory in *data, and then
+wants to bounds-check writes to that region, but was mistakenly using
+a bare 'data' instead of '*data'. Also, data is declared as void **,
+so we need a cast to turn it into a byte pointer so we can actually do
+pointer comparisons.
